Transaction 295849cc13353aa54ed4eeb082c88c592a2173d690415781904ddf5bfe0bfcf0

1 Input
2 Outputs
  • 295849cc13353aa54ed4eeb082c88c592a2173d690415781904ddf5bfe0bfcf0:0
  • value  97000
    address  351rMmLa4nHx7tsNCdZmfjimCZivTJ1REM
  • 295849cc13353aa54ed4eeb082c88c592a2173d690415781904ddf5bfe0bfcf0:1
  • value  14175952
    address  1FA2eQkJTSpjBCxohHEdwzGUj3SskohgCw